Gabe Roman of Oxnard High captured the 147-pound championship of the Southern Section Division I wrestling finals Saturday night at El Monte High.

In a two-day meet dominated by eventual champion Santa Ana Cavalry Chapel, Roman (37-0) recorded two victories by decision and one by pin before defeating Ponteyo Tabarez of Central, 15-2, for the title.

Roman was among five Channel League champions wrestling Saturday, and the only one of four to win a championship bout. Rio Mesa’s Tom Nelford (154 pounds), Jessie Campos (132) and Jesse Bautista (127) all were outpointed in finals.

Ryan Burdick of Ventura (191) was defeated in a semifinal match.

“Actually, I expected to win,” Roman said. “It’s just my attitude this year. This is something I didn’t want last year. The cutting weight started getting to me toward the end and I wanted my season to end early.

“This year is different.”

Two-time defending state champion Calvary Chapel totaled 264.5 points to claim its fourth consecutive section title. Six of 13 weight championships were won by Calvary Chapel.

Canyon Springs (151 points) finished second and Dos Pueblos (121) was third, with Rio Mesa (92.5) fifth.

Nelford (53-5) was defeated by Josh Holiday of Calvary Chapel, 10-5. Holiday (42-0), a two-time section champion and defending state champion, improved to 93-1 over the past two seasons.

Bautista (38-8) was overwhelmed by Joe Calizitta of Calvary Chapel, 14-4.

Campos (39-5) lost to Alexei Yawauarae (51-2) of Anaheim Canyon, 11-8.
